Ok I cant figure this out, i need some help.

When I first got my tune way back when the car would jump at the slightest touch of the throttle from idle(auto trans). I got used to it but it was always there. about 2 months ago (max) I started hearing bangs everytime I decelled into first no matter what speed i was going. It was weak at first, got progressively worse and now that jump is gone. 1st gear takes longer to get out of when Im WOT. And now everytime it shifts I hear a friggin squeek on accell.


I took it to the dealer they couldnt find the problem. I have extended warranty so im sure they are busting my balls.

Any ideas? Im ready to do some serious work on this car soon and I want it to be in tip top.



Edit: The squeek may be the drivers seat, anyone had the squeeky seat before?

yes i have had the sqeaky driver seat i fixed it myself with foam.mine was the lumbar button rubing put the foam in between the button and the plastic pieace it was rubbing.and also try to reflash your tune and also try cleaning your maf sensor and reclabrate your throttle.try those thats what works on mine but the number one thing these autos need is gears mine will snap your neck off if i am not carefull with the throttle i have frp 410 gears and 93 race tune.
